Outline of Final Research Achievements

The aim of this study is to develop the spatial biomass prediction model of fish and benthic invertebrate in the water system of Saba River. Field surveys were conducted to understand the relation between hydraulic characteristics and biomass of fish and benthic invertebrate, and we established GLM to predict the biomass using the hydraulic characteristics. The change amount of biomass of benthic invertebrate in mainstream of Saba River is predicted by using GLM and calculated hydraulic characteristics by fluid models. The result revealed that the total biomass of fish and benthic invertebrate was reduced by the negative impact of water intake.
